In 'Fantasy Realm — Naruto: Blood-Mist,' the jutsu arsenal is a thrilling mix of nostalgia and innovation. Classic techniques like the Shadow Clone and Chidori return but are reimagined with eerie twists—think clones that dissolve into blood mist or lightning infused with dark chakra. The real gems are the entirely new jutsu, though. The Blood-Mist Barrier, for instance, lets users vanish into a crimson fog, striking from invisibility. Another standout is the Crimson Vine Technique, where chakra manifests as barbed, blood-red tendrils that drain an opponent’s energy on contact.

The antagonists wield even more terrifying abilities, like the Bone Shard Storm, which turns their skeleton into projectile weapons. Protagonists counter with Lotus of the Blood Moon, a genjutsu that traps foes in an endless loop of their worst memories. What’s fascinating is how these jutsu reflect the story’s darker tone—less about flashy battles, more about psychological and visceral horror. The creativity here isn’t just in power scaling but in how each technique deepens the narrative’s gothic atmosphere.

How does 'Fantasy Realm — Naruto: Blood-Mist' differ from the original Naruto?

4 Answers2025-06-08 22:43:24
'Fantasy Realm — Naruto: Blood-Mist' takes the familiar world of 'Naruto' and plunges it into a darker, grittier dimension. The original's emphasis on camaraderie and growth is replaced by a survival-of-the-fittest ethos, where the Blood-Mist Village's brutal graduation ritual—killing one's peers—sets the tone. Characters like Zabuza and Haku aren’t tragic outliers but reflections of the norm, their ruthlessness amplified. The chakra system remains, but techniques lean toward blood magic and forbidden arts, with jutsu often requiring sacrifices. The narrative shifts from Naruto’s underdog journey to a morally ambiguous struggle for power. The Bijuu aren’t just weapons; they’re eldritch horrors worshipped by cults. Even the Uzumaki clan’s sealing arts have a sinister twist, binding souls rather than tails. The story explores themes of corruption and decay, stripping away the original’s hopeful veneer. It’s 'Naruto' through a horror lens, where every shadow whispers violence.

Is 'Fantasy Realm — Naruto: Blood-Mist' canon to the Naruto universe?

4 Answers2025-06-08 14:45:34
I can confidently say 'Fantasy Realm — Naruto: Blood-Mist' isn't part of the official canon. The Naruto universe, as defined by Masashi Kishimoto, includes only the manga, its direct anime adaptations, and a few spin-offs like 'Boruto.' 'Blood-Mist' feels more like an elaborate fanfiction—rich in creativity but lacking the narrative cohesion of canon material. It introduces rogue ninja clans and bloodline abilities that clash with established lore, like the Uzumaki clan's sealing techniques being rewritten entirely. The tone also diverges sharply; it leans into gothic horror, whereas canon Naruto balances tragedy with hope. That said, its world-building is impressive, crafting a self-contained story that could stand alone if not for borrowed characters. Fans debate its merits, but canon purists dismiss it outright.
